Pomoc - Szukaj - Użytkownicy - Kalendarz
Pełna wersja: [PHP][inne]odsyłacz do zdjęcia w sieci intranet
Forum PHP.pl > Forum > Przedszkole
pjanek
Prosze o pomoc w rozwiązaniu problemu.
W sieni Intranetowej mam postawionego Xampp-a. Mam pliki ze zdjęciami na sieci do których mam linki. Pliki ze zdjeciami nie sa w katalogu xampp-a tylko na sieci.
Do dzisiaj w IE działało pod kodem (w Firefox nie działało, ale wystarczyło że chodziło pod IE):
Kod
$katalog=/katalog_projektu

Kod
$zdjecie=/zdjecie

Kod
<img src="\\172.20.2.112\katalog1\katalog2\ARCHIWUM\<?php echo $katalog?>/<?php echo $zdjecie?>.png" width="250" height="150" border="1"/>

Powyższy kod wyświetlał fotkę, ale dziś zaktualizowałem Windowsa i powyższy link nic nie wyświetla.
Proszę o informację jaka jest właśiwa konstrukcja ściezki w w/w środowisku i jakieś wyjaśnienie dlaczego po aktualizacji przestało działać
usb2.0
a wyswietlales sobie ta sciezke w np. echo?
i jestes pewny ze normalnie dziala?
pjanek
skoro działało jak wstawiałem
Kod
<?php echo $katalog?>/<?php echo $zdjecie?>
to nie próbowałem podstawiać scieżki ponieważ ścieszka pobierana jest z bazy mysql i jest do każdego projektu inna.
Ale teraz jak przestało działać to do testów wstawiłem linki
Kod
<img src="\\172.20.2.112//cnc//foto.png" width="250" height="150" border="1"/>
i taki
Kod
<img src="//172.20.2.112//cnc//foto.png" width="250" height="150" border="1"/>
i nic. Ręce opadają.
werdan
Skoro masz serwer XAMP to czemu nie odwołujesz sie przez http:// . Sprawdz czy działa z http://172.20.2.112/cnc/foto.png
pjanek
Ad1. Link http://172.20.2.112/cnc/foto.png działa.
Ad2. Problem jest banalny na serwerze mam ograniczoną ilość miejsca, natomiast projektów jest sporo i są to duże katalogi
więc trzymamy je na sieci. Nie sądzę aby udało mi się przekonać włodarzy żebym miał więcej miejsca, musze sobie poradzić z tym co mam sad.gif
Ale nadal nie mogę zrozumieć dlaczego link przestał działać po aktualizacji, bez żadnej ingerencji w kod.
werdan
Zobacz czy masz bład na konsoli.
Moim zdaniem, w końcu naprawiono w IE sytuacje odczytu obrazku z sieci lokalnej przez <img>, która widocznie stanowiła jakies zagrożenie skoro tylko tam działało Ci to rozwiazanie.

U mnie na chrome dostaje komunikat: Not allowed to load local resource

Pogrzeb jeszcze w ustawieniach prywatnosci przegladarki, moze jest tam cos co rozwiaze twój problem.
pjanek
nie wiem czy ot to Ci chodzi ale w przeglądarne w miejscu img nie mam czerwonego "X" (tak jest gdy podam inny adres gdzie nie ma foto) tylko jest ramka z mała ikonką. Nie wygląda mi to na zły adres tylko właśnie na jakąś blokadę, której nie mogę rozszyfrować.
werdan
Napisz jakiej wersji IE uzywasz i jaki Windows.

Otwórz console (F12), znajdz zakadkę Console, przeładuj strone i zobacz lub wklej co sie tam pojawiło.

Wejdz w "ustawienia internetowe"->Zabezpieczenia->Lokalny intranet i ustaw na "niski" lub pogrzeb w ustawieniach poziomu niestandardowego.


pjanek
Wersja IE to 9.0.8 a system to Windows 7
W konsoli po odświeżeniu jest tylko
Kod
SEC7115: Style :visited i :link mogą się różnić jedynie kolorem. Pewne style nie zostały zastosowane do stylu :visited.
index2.php


Odgrzewam temat bo nadal nie doszedłem do tego dlaczego nie ma zdjęć po aktualizacji IE 9.
Zrobiłem jeszcze jeden eksperyment w konsoli IE dałem raport obrazów. I o dziwo w raporcie
jest zdjęcie z linkiem jak poniżej
Kod
file://172.20.2.112/katalog1/katalog2/KATALOG3/katalog4/katalog5/zdjecie.png
Natomiast w przeglądarce jest nadal obraz zastępczy (nie czerwony X).
Proszę o pomoc. A i dodam jeszcze, że otworzyłem swoją stronę w IE 7 i tam fotki wyświetlają się bez problemu.
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ę kliknij tutaj.
Invision Power Board © 2001-2025 Invision Power Services, Inc.